Joseph2017China is absolutely correct - there is no "obligation" (written, spoken or implied) that any of us tip over and above what the cruise line already adds in every single food or beverage purchase made on board (or in advance).  Our decision whether or not to tip additionally (and how much) is always made on a case-by-case basis, and is ENTIRELY predicated on the quality and level of service provided by those who serve us.  For example, we like to find one or two bars with excellent bartenders and stick to them all week.  The more "generous" the barkeep, the more generous we tend to be in return.

    Has anyone has issues with RCCL credit card points that were redeemed for onboard credit? I have 800 worth. I am hoping I am not told you lose this by rescheduling??

    Bri, DW and I had $250 on a PR Cruise leaving Marc 28th.  TA cancelled for us.  I had to call Royal about the OBC.  When I finally reached someone, I was told that I would NOT be getting those points back on the CC.  What I'm supposed to do is hold onto the Redemption Confirmation, and when we re-book they will apply it for us.  Haven't tried it yet, so we'll see...
